Abhayapur Village

Abhayapur is an inhabited village in Jarada Tahasil of Ganjam district, Odisha. Its Census village code is 413274, the Census 2011 record lists 639 people in 174 households and the reported area is 68 hectares. The local references include Jaradagada Gram Panchayat, Patrapur CD Block and the nearest town reference is Brahmapur at about 48 km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Abhayapur show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, Pulses and Biri, net sown area is 53.33 hectares and irrigated land is 29.61 hectares (55.5%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
